summaryrefslogtreecommitdiff
path: root/mk
diff options
context:
space:
mode:
authorkristerw <kristerw@pkgsrc.org>2007-01-28 19:23:22 +0000
committerkristerw <kristerw@pkgsrc.org>2007-01-28 19:23:22 +0000
commitd96a55141212398c263986869cd0a7250cd4f8fa (patch)
treeb2959b2190b5510852716d0b8246a612816e2bd0 /mk
parent63634167d10f81ed0754a7ab76a286ecbae4f847 (diff)
downloadpkgsrc-d96a55141212398c263986869cd0a7250cd4f8fa.tar.gz
Remove old .bulk-not_available (NOT_AVAILABLE_FILE) files that are left
from previous run.
Diffstat (limited to 'mk')
-rw-r--r--mk/bulk/pre-build8
1 files changed, 7 insertions, 1 deletions
diff --git a/mk/bulk/pre-build b/mk/bulk/pre-build
index 249f92f646f..ca888a16bda 100644
--- a/mk/bulk/pre-build
+++ b/mk/bulk/pre-build
@@ -1,5 +1,5 @@
#!/bin/sh
-# $NetBSD: pre-build,v 1.65 2007/01/24 02:48:51 rillig Exp $
+# $NetBSD: pre-build,v 1.66 2007/01/28 19:23:22 kristerw Exp $
#
# Clean up system to be ready for bulk pkg build
#
@@ -34,6 +34,11 @@ if [ "$BROKENF" = "" ]; then
echo "pre-build> Had problems determining the name of the .broken files"
exit 1
fi
+NOTAVAILF=`( cd ${PKGLINT_PKG_DIR} ; ${BMAKE} show-var VARNAME=NOT_AVAILABLE_FILE )`;
+if [ "$NOTAVAILF" = "" ]; then
+ echo "pre-build> Had problems determining the name of the .bulk-not_available files"
+ exit 1
+fi
BRKWRKLOG=`( cd ${PKGLINT_PKG_DIR} ; ${BMAKE} show-var VARNAME=BROKENWRKLOG )`;
if [ "$BRKWRKLOG" = "" ]; then
echo "pre-build> Had problems determining the name of the .broken.work files"
@@ -167,6 +172,7 @@ rm -fr /tmp/mod*
cd "${USR_PKGSRC}"
echo "pre-build> Cleaning up leftover state files from previous runs"
rm -f "${BULKFILESDIR}"/*/*/$BROKENF "${BULKFILESDIR}"/*/*/$BRKWRKLOG "${BULKFILESDIR}"/*/*/$BLDLOG
+rm -f "${BULKFILESDIR}"/*/*/$NOTAVAILF
rm -f "${BULKFILESDIR}/$BROKENF" "${BULKFILESDIR}/$BRKWRKLOG" "${BULKFILESDIR}/$BLDLOG" "$STARTFILE"